How Garment Construction Changes Fit & Function
Clothing styles may appear similar at first glance, but differences in construction can significantly affect comfort, movement and performance. Features such as side seams, panel construction, collar design, cuffs and pocket placement all contribute to how a garment fits and functions. These details often distinguish casual apparel from garments designed for workplace, sporting or hospitality environments.
Additional construction elements such as reinforced stitching, stretch panels, ribbed trims and articulated sleeves can improve durability and freedom of movement. Jackets and workwear often incorporate extra reinforcement in high-stress areas, while activewear and healthcare garments may prioritise flexibility and comfort. These design variations help determine how well a garment performs in different working and recreational settings.
What features should I look for in workwear clothing?Common considerations include fabric durability, reinforced stitching, freedom of movement, pocket design and suitability for the working environment. The most important features will vary depending on the type of work being performed.
Why do some jackets feel warmer than others even when they look similar?Warmth is influenced by insulation materials, fabric construction, lining design and how effectively the garment traps air. Two jackets with a similar appearance can perform very differently in colder conditions.
What makes a garment comfortable to wear for long periods?Comfort is affected by factors such as fabric softness, breathability, stretch, fit and overall garment construction. Features that reduce restriction and improve airflow often contribute to better long-term comfort.
How do stretch panels improve clothing performance?Stretch panels allow greater freedom of movement without requiring the entire garment to be made from stretch fabric. They are commonly used in workwear, activewear and healthcare apparel where mobility is important.
What causes seams to fail on frequently worn garments?Seam failure is often linked to repeated stress, abrasion and movement around high-wear areas. Stitch density, thread quality and reinforcement methods can all influence the lifespan of a garment.
Sales Tip: Why do some jackets last significantly longer than others?A tip from Kylie on our sales team: Fabric weight is only part of the story. Areas such as zips, cuffs, seams and pocket attachments often experience the greatest wear. A well-constructed jacket with reinforced stress points will frequently outlast a heavier garment with weaker construction.
Garment Construction & Performance Considerations
Many of the differences between clothing styles come down to fabric selection, panel design, stitching methods and reinforcement techniques. Workwear, activewear, jackets, healthcare apparel and hospitality garments are often engineered to address specific performance requirements such as durability, mobility, insulation or moisture management. Looking beyond the appearance of a garment and understanding how it is constructed can provide valuable insight into how it will perform in everyday use.
